Lionel Messi was on his invincible element with a goal and three assists as he inspired Inter Miami to a 4-0 win over Cincinnati to reach the MLS Eastern Conference final for the first time ever.

During the building to the encounter, Softfootball had predicted a win for Inter Miami in the winner takes all semi-final and they came out top, even exceeding the 3-2 prediction by not conceding a goal. Cincinnati battled hard against Inter Miami but the genius of Messi was the major difference.

Interestingly, Inter Miami qualified for the play-offs as the third-placed team in the Eastern Conference after finishing a point behind Philadelphia Union and level on points with Cincinnati. Inter Miami beat Nashville in the play-offs quarter-final to set up a clash with Cincinnati.

Messi opened scoring in the first half at TQL Stadium when he got to Mateo Silvetti’s perfect cross and headed home. He returned the favour by setting up the 19-year-old to score in the second half to make it 2-0.

The 8-time Ballon D’Or winner then provided two more assists for Tadeo Allende to get his brace in a complete blow out in front of 25,513 fans in attendance. Javier Mascherano’s Inter Miami will face Philadelphia or New York City in the MLS Cup final.
